Needed a way to strap down my new [Flight Test Gremlin](https://store.flitetest.com/ft-gremlin/) to my backpack for easy transport and took a cue from the [Tiny Whoop Bracket](https://www.thingiverse.com/thing:2149897).
Add hoops and straps instead of hooks (also prints much better, no support needed) and this is the result.
You then just need to supply a velcro batter strap that I'm sure you have lying around, a short piece of cord, print out a [cord stop](https://www.thingiverse.com/thing:1642981) and strap it to your backpack!
I have 2 designs, one with a large hole or one with slots. one should suit your needs!
Tips:
When choosing the cord, make sure that a simple overhand knot can fit through the hole in both the print and cord toggle. Strap down your quad like you would normally, tighten down the toggle then tie a simple overhand knot just past the toggle, this could save everything coming apart in a jolt or drop! Simple safety measure!
